Successful neighborhood bread and pastry makers during pandemic

Photos of a neighborhood pop-up started by Ryan and Daniella, two chefs who were laid off early in the pandemic. They have had tremendous success in the last year, with the entire neighborhood rallying around them (painting signs, installing a doorbell, buying them out of bread every day, etc.)
